Seite 3 von 4

Re: Wetterstation 3.Generation bald nötig

Verfasst: 25 Sep 2022, 19:17
von Route56
Hab den Fehler :D
anstatt Port 45000 hatte ich 4500 angegeben :x

die IP stimmt
Port 45000

Router (Fritzbox 7490)
Selbständige Portfreigabe sowohl dem Server als auch dem GW1100 zugelassen.
Beide bekommen auch immer die gleiche IP
b) muss ggf. , je nach Router, dieser Adresse erlaubt werden, mit anderen Geräten (IP-Adressen) im lokalen Netzwerk zu kommunizieren.
das ist auch aktiviert, gilt aber nur für WLAN untereinander. Jedoch ist der Server per LAN am Router.

Dank Dir nochmals für die schnelle Hilfe!

Re: Wetterstation 3.Generation bald nötig

Verfasst: 25 Sep 2022, 19:20
von Gyvate
Route56 hat geschrieben: 25 Sep 2022, 19:17 Hab den Fehler :D
anstatt Port 45000 hatte ich 4500 angegeben :x

die IP stimmt
Port 45000
wäre nicht nötig gewesen 8-) - den Port 45000 (Standard für das GW1000 etc. API) wählt der Ecowitt Gateway Treiber selbstständig, solange nichts anderes angegeben wird.
Dank Dir nochmals für die schnelle Hilfe!
Das Forum hat eine Danke-/Bedankungsfunktion ;)

Keine Ursache.
Ich habe mich selbst von der Pike auf in weewx einarbeiten müssen und weiss, dass es hakelig sein kann, je nach (Vor-)Kenntnissen mit RasPi, Linux, Programmiersprachen etc.

Re: Wetterstation 3.Generation bald nötig

Verfasst: 25 Sep 2022, 19:33
von Route56
Bei der neoground Skin ist das etwas aufwändiger - da musst Du, insbesondere in der neowx skin.conf, die zusätzlichen Sensoren ggf. noch eintragen, bevor sie angezeigt werden. Das gilt sowohl für die Kacheln als auch für die Zeichnungen.
ja da muß ich wohl noch ran
UV Index und Wind Speed sind vorhanden
Gust Speed, Solar Irradiance, Day Wind Max nicht.

Re: Wetterstation 3.Generation bald nötig

Verfasst: 25 Sep 2022, 19:39
von Gyvate
ich würde erst mal versuchen, alles mit der Seasons-Skin zum Laufen zu bekommen.
Das ist ja fast out-of-the-box. Bei Seasons enable = true und die HTML_ROOT setzen.
Einfach unterschiedliche Verzeichnisse für Seasons und neowx wählen
z.B. HTML_ROOT = /var/www/html/weewx für Seasons und HTML_ROOT = /var/www/html/neowx für neowx
das Verzeichnis muss ggf. zuvor einmalig mit sudo mkdir .../html/neowx bzw .../html/weewx angelegt werden.
Dann ist auch klar, ob alle Variablen richtig angesprochen werden.

Danach ist die analoge Übertragung nach neowx halb so wild.

Re: Wetterstation 3.Generation bald nötig

Verfasst: 25 Sep 2022, 19:46
von Gyvate
Für den GW1000 Treiber muss übrigens in
[StdCalibrate]
[[Corrections]] der Eintrag

radiation = luminosity / 126.7 if luminosity is not None else None
stehen. 8-)

Re: Wetterstation 3.Generation bald nötig

Verfasst: 26 Sep 2022, 12:19
von Route56
Gyvate hat geschrieben: 25 Sep 2022, 19:39 ich würde erst mal versuchen, alles mit der Seasons-Skin zum Laufen zu bekommen.
Das ist ja fast out-of-the-box. Bei Seasons enable = true und die HTML_ROOT setzen.
Einfach unterschiedliche Verzeichnisse für Seasons und neowx wählen
z.B. HTML_ROOT = /var/www/html/weewx für Seasons und HTML_ROOT = /var/www/html/neowx für neowx
das Verzeichnis muss ggf. zuvor einmalig mit sudo mkdir .../html/neowx bzw .../html/weewx angelegt werden.
Dann ist auch klar, ob alle Variablen richtig angesprochen werden.

Danach ist die analoge Übertragung nach neowx halb so wild.
ja habe ich gestern Abend noch gemacht, funktioniert!
In Seasons alles ok, bis auf "Evapotranspiration" die bei beiden Skins angezeigt wird.
Besitze aber gar keinen Sensor dafür :?:
Gust Speed Kachel in neowx fehlt noch.

Korrektur für Luminosity auch eingetragen.

Re: Wetterstation 3.Generation bald nötig

Verfasst: 26 Sep 2022, 13:40
von Gyvate
Evapotranspiration ist wie z.B. der Taupunkt, Heatindex, Windchill etc. eine abgeleitete, berechnete Größe.
Dabei werden zur Berechnung Sensorwerte wie Temperatur, Luftfeuchte und Luftdruck, Windgeschwindigkeit und Solarstrahlung dafür herangezogen.

"Evapotranspiration bezeichnet in der Meteorologie die Summe aus Transpiration und Evaporation, also der Verdunstung von Wasser aus Tier- und Pflanzenwelt sowie von Boden- und Wasseroberflächen.
....
Eine weit verbreitete Methode zur Messung der Evapotranspiration stellt die Berechnung aus den oben angeführten klimatischen Faktoren nach einer von der FAO empfohlenen Methode dar („modified Penman-Monteith“ Formel, FAO-56). Dabei werden die notwendigen Parameter – Lufttemperatur und relative Feuchte, Windgeschwindigkeit und Solarstrahlung – durch eine Wetterstation aufgezeichnet und in einem Computermodell verarbeitet. Diese so genannte Referenzverdunstung (ETo) entspricht der Verdunstung, wie sie auf einer ebenen, gleichmäßig mit Gras bewachsenen Fläche vorkommen würde."

Re: Wetterstation 3.Generation bald nötig

Verfasst: 26 Sep 2022, 13:56
von Route56
Ok, hatte ich bei Wikipedia auch gefunden nur nicht so weit runter gescrolled bis zur Modellrechnung.

Re: Wetterstation 3.Generation bald nötig

Verfasst: 26 Sep 2022, 14:08
von Gyvate
Route56 hat geschrieben: 26 Sep 2022, 12:19 Gust Speed Kachel in neowx fehlt noch.
dann ist sie wahrscheinlich unter values_order in der skin.conf nicht eingetragen

Re: Wetterstation 3.Generation bald nötig

Verfasst: 26 Sep 2022, 14:49
von zinz
Route56 hat geschrieben: 25 Sep 2022, 19:17
Router (Fritzbox 7490)
Selbständige Portfreigabe sowohl dem Server als auch dem GW1100 zugelassen.
Beide bekommen auch immer die gleiche IP
b) muss ggf. , je nach Router, dieser Adresse erlaubt werden, mit anderen Geräten (IP-Adressen) im lokalen Netzwerk zu kommunizieren.
das ist auch aktiviert, gilt aber nur für WLAN untereinander. Jedoch ist der Server per LAN am Router.

Dank Dir nochmals für die schnelle Hilfe!
Ich hoffe mal das deine Geräte nicht selbständig ports ins WAN freigeben dürfen.
Aber andere Portfreigaben kenne ich nicht in der Fritzbox.